Koppelstraat is a street in the historic center of Bredevoort. The street starts as a side street of the Landstraat and continues all the way to the Winterswijksestraat where the Schaarsbeek flows.
In the past, Koppelstraat ended at the point where the Georgiuskerk now stands, against the city wall. At the height of the entrance to the church, there was a large roundel, where the street branched off into "Achterstraat", Officierstraat, and 't Walletje. After the dismantling of the fortifications of Bredevoort, Koppelstraat was extended and continued. The section between the Sint Georgiuskerk and Tolhuisweg used to be called Koppeldijk. There is a tendency to think that the "coupling" of this street to the outside explains the name. The opposite is true; the name comes from the field name De Koppele, a community pasture located in the Zwanenbroek. The Koppelkerk is also named after it.
